What I would like to know is how one can get the full URL of the
currently selected link without actually opening it. An example of
this might be a download link to a file; I would be interested in
copying this direct link in case to pass along in a tweet or email or
something. So I don't want to
Once you have focus on a link you can pull up the contextual menu
(VO-shift-M) and then arrow down to "Copy Link". Of course if the link
is 'fake' where it really just fires off a bunch of script which loads a
bunch of stuff then there might not be a link to copy.

Another way you could possibly do it is to press VO-shift-U to hear the address
of the current link, then press VO-shift-C to copy the last spoken phrase to
the clipboard. This might be slightly quicker than going to "copy link."

If by header you mean heading, then just interact with the heading and
vo-right or left until you are on the link, then vo-space.
